We are looking for an experienced Lead Gameplay Programmer with strong expertise in Unreal Engine (UE4/UE5) and gameplay systems design. This role is responsible for leading the development of core gameplay mechanics, player controls, systems architecture, and game features for a high-quality AAA game project.
You will lead a team of gameplay engineers, set technical standards, and work closely with design, animation, and other engineering teams to deliver scalable, responsive, and high-performance gameplay for mobile and browser platforms.
This is a senior leadership role with clear ownership of gameplay feel, responsiveness, and depth.
Key Responsibilities1. Gameplay Systems Leadership- Lead, mentor, and guide a team of gameplay programmers.
- Define coding standards, best practices, and gameplay architecture.
- Work closely with game designers to turn creative ideas into solid, scalable gameplay systems.
- Design, build, and optimize gameplay mechanics, player systems, match logic, AI behaviors, and feature modules.
- Develop responsive player controls, camera systems, physics-based interactions, and gameplay frameworks.
- Create modular and reusable systems that support fast iteration and live updates.
- Work closely with Design, Animation, Tech Art, VFX, Engine, and QA teams.
- Integrate gameplay systems with animation blueprints, UI, networking layers, and engine-level features.
- Provide technical input during planning, prototyping, and production phases.
- Profile and optimize gameplay code for performance on mobile and browser platforms.
- Ensure gameplay systems are stable, scalable, and easy to maintain.
- Lead debugging efforts, performance reviews, and code quality checks throughout development.
